What is shrinkage compensated?

Shrinkage-compensating concrete is made with an expansive cement or expansive component system in which initial expansion, if properly restrained, offsets strains caused by drying shrinkage. Shrinkage-compensating concrete is used to minimize cracking and structural movement caused by drying shrinkage in concrete.

What is Type K cement?

Type K cement is an expansive cement, as defined by ASTM C845. [1] Type K cement contains anhydrous calcium aluminate, which contributes to its expansive properties. [2] Compared to conventional Type I cement, Type K cement exhibits a greater increase in volume during hydration.

What is Class C grout?

Class C grouts: (also known as Performance Grouts) are shrinkage compensated (non-shrink) during both the plastic and post hardened state.

How thick can non shrink grout be?

For many applications, it may be placed up to 6 inches (150 mm) in depth without the extension. When placing at depths over 3 inches (75 mm) and the surface area is over 2 ft2 (0.19 m2), the product should be extended.

What is shrinkage compensating concrete?

A: Shrinkage-compensating concrete is made with either expansive cement, or with normal cement and an expansive component that’s added separately. It’s proportioned so the concrete will increase in volume after setting and during early-age hardening.

What is epoxy based grout?

Epoxy resin based grouts are generally formulated to be used within a range of gap sizes to ensure shrinkage is controlled. One of the features of epoxy based grouts is their ability to bond to the concrete foundation and the base plate.
